Output 705cc3cd46bbd71e8317fcd89f96485424c2d0db25fbbb6db650ab68d5e0f133:0

value
522051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c729b00c8fb5609a32f6f89aa9a8b3ad90ca39c OP_EQUAL
address
3BaSCBxsfaKrNkbJFLrFYkuNZ3MKnxgJEy
transaction
705cc3cd46bbd71e8317fcd89f96485424c2d0db25fbbb6db650ab68d5e0f133
confirmations
45615
spent
true